Bones Bar

Fodor's choice

This trendy spot on the waterfront at Pelican Bay Hotel is a popular evening and late-night watering hole with the local expat crowd, with swim-up seating at the adjacent pool. Sip high-end tasting rums or fresh-squeezed cocktails like the Silver Fox (lime juice, homemade simple syrup, and vodka). The only food option is their delicious homemade savory meat pies. Call ahead to place your order as they tend to run out early.

Rum Runners

Fodor's choice

This busy bar on the corner of Count Basie Square specializes in keeping bar hoppers young and old supplied with free Wi-Fi, tropical frozen drinks and punches, and piña coladas served in coconuts. Sit outside for people-watching or inside for cool air-conditioning and TVs broadcasting sports events. The kitchen serves up basic American and Bahamian bar food. Happy hour is daily from 5 to 7.

Coral Beach Bar and Restaurant

At the popular and long-standing condominium property Coral Beach Hotel, this spacious, open-air bar bustles with visitors and locals, too. Bartenders serve up tropical drinks and cold beer to a lively crowd with music in the background. The menu boasts Bahamian favorites like conch fritters along with burgers and sweet-potato fries. Situated poolside and beachfront to Coral Beach, this spot is fun for lunch and a daytime drink, too.
